How they compare
Mexico currently reports 13.98 Mt CO2e against 13.54 Mt CO2e in Vietnam, a difference of 0.44 Mt CO2e.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Vietnam ahead.
Mexico ranks 33rd and Vietnam ranks 36th of 183 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Mexico averaged higher in 2 and Vietnam in 1.
